PRS-EU8050, 50 kN and PRS-EU8300, 300 kN capacity fully automatic Electromechanical ParsRos Universal Testing Machines are multi purpose versatile machines which satisfy the requirement of R&D laboratories, university laboratories, institute laboratories and quality control laboratories for tensile, compression flexural tests under load or displacement control for a wide range of materials. PRS-EU8050 and PRS-EU8300 model Electromechanical Universal Testing Machines can be used for tensile test on any material i.e (metal, plastic, textile, wood) by using suitable accessories. Those machines can also be used for general compression, flexural, test on steel, soil, concrete, cement, asphalt and similar materials, by using suitable accessories.
These Testing Machines consist of base containing the transmission components and holds two robust columns connected by upper cross head and digital graphics data acquisition and control system. The upper cross head can be adjusted to set the vertical test space for different tests. User can adjust the vertical test space by also lower crosshead moved by an electromechanical system with a single recirculating ball screw, powered by an servomotor.
Advanced closed loop control system assures accurate load or displacement pace rate on sample.
The load is measured by a load cell that located on upper crosshead and displacement is measured by an encoder fit to the servo motor on both models.
The operator will have large flexibility during the test with advanced microprocessor control and material testing software installed on PC.
The machine is supplied complete with high precision load cell. Gripping systems, extensometers and accessories are not included and have to be ordered separately.

PRSM-4000 Universal Hydraulic Tensile Test Machine is designed to test the ferrous materials for structural values such as yield strength and tensile strength. Apart from tensile tests, Universal Test Machines can also be used for compression tests up to the capacity of the machine.
Maximum security is maintained on 600kN capacity Universal Test Machine by limit switch on the lower grip and piston as well as the safety check valves on the hydraulic system. Hydraulic power unit works silently.0-40 mm flat and 8-32 mm round samples can be tested with a user friendly hydraulic jaws that comply with standards.
Load cell is used for load measurements. Strain measurement is done by the electronic displacement transducer built in the machine if required external extensometer fitted to the specimen also can be used for strain measurement. Strain measurements can be done directly from the extensometer fitted to the specimen.
Tests can be done fully automatic by digital control unit or computer. Machine complete the test with the set pace rate and turns to start position automatically.
PRSM-4000 Hydraulic Universal Testing Machine, features two test spaces for tension tests and compression tests. User can quickly change between tension and compression testing without having to remove heavy fixtures. This flexible design also helps to ensure safety, reduces operator effort and improves productivity.
The distance between the grips can be set by motor driven hand set system. With open front hydraulic wedge grips user can load specimen easily.
